Q1
The amount of Rs. 7500 at compound interest at 4% per annum for 2 years, is :
  • A Rs. 7800
  • B Rs. 8100
  • C Rs. 8112
  • D Rs. 8082
Answer: Option C
Q2
If the interest on a sum of money at 5% per annum for 3 years is Rs. 1200, the compount interest on the same sum for the same period at the same rate, is :
  • A Rs. 1260
  • B Rs. 1261
  • C Rs. 1264
  • D Rs. 1265
Answer: Option B
Q3
If the difference between the compound interest, compounded half yearly and the simple interest on a sum at 10% per annum for one year is rs. 25, the sum is :
  • A Rs 9000
  • B Rs. 9500
  • C Rs. 10000
  • D Rs. 10500
Answer: Option C
